I am fine with the comments that were printed in the newspaper, but I was misquoted. I had a lot more to say than what was written. I said that when an unkown wins the WSOP ME, the general consensus is that he probably isn't a top player and got lucky. Joe plays like a pro, though, and his approach to the game is similar to that of the other top pros.

I never said the others sucked at all. I said that the general consensus is that they got lucky and can't really play. After winning the WSOP ME an unknown must struggle to prove themselves as a legit player, and Joe has done that not only with his results, but more importantly, with play.

This whole thing is so ridiculous it's unbelievable. I said something nice about Joe and people go nuts. No, I don't think it was innapropriate to lump Raymer in there with Moneymaker and Gold. I certainly wasn't going to put him in the same group as Hachem and Mortensen because I don't believe he's as good a player as they are. Shoot me.

I think your being dishonest about the "general consensus". Saying it's that someone got lucky is one thing, saying that they can't really play is another, and will naturally be taken as an insult.

The fact that Greg had as high a finish as he did the very next year would tend to affect the "general consensus", don't you think?

Your statement comes off more like, "in my circle, the general consensus is that they got lucky and can't really play". There's nothing ridiculous or unbelievable about the reaction you are getting at all. Most people will probably see a big difference between "not as good a player as Hachem" and "can't really play".
